Clinical Psychologist – Residential Care & Specialist SEMH School

Location: Ripponden, West Yorkshire
Salary: Band 7/8a equivalent- depending on experience, pro rata
Hours: Full-time / Part-time considered
Contract: Permanent

“Help children heal, connect, and thrive.”

We are seeking a compassionate and skilled Clinical Psychologist to join our therapeutic team within a dynamic, trauma-informed service for children and young people living in residential care and attending our specialist SEMH school.

Our integrated model combines residential care, specialist education, and clinical input to provide holistic support for children with complex trauma histories, attachment difficulties, and neurodevelopmental needs. As part of a multidisciplinary team, you will play a central role in supporting recovery, relational repair, and emotional development.

What You’ll Be Doing:
  • Conducting psychological assessments and formulations
  • Delivering individual, group, and systemic interventions
  • Supporting staff teams through consultation, reflective practice, and training
  • Working closely with education and care colleagues to embed trauma-informed practice
  • Contributing to care planning, risk assessment, and outcome monitoring
  • Engaging families where possible in therapeutic and systemic work
What We Offer:
  • Opportunity to train in Dyadic Developmental Psychotherapy (DDP), with supervision from accredited practitioners
  • A supportive clinical team with regular supervision and CPD
  • The chance to influence whole-system thinking in a truly child-centred setting
  • Access to a broad, multidisciplinary team including SLTs, OTs, and art therapists
  • A working culture that values reflective practice, curiosity, and relational safety
What We’re Looking For:
  • HCPC-registered Clinical Psychologist (newly qualified or experienced)
  • Experience or interest in working with looked-after children, complex trauma, and SEMH needs
  • A collaborative, emotionally attuned approach and commitment to trauma-informed care
  • Knowledge of attachment theory, systemic thinking, and therapeutic models such as DDP, CAT, EMDR, or ACT is desirable
